What Does the Bible say about Dreams of Suffocation?

The Bible does not directly address dreams of suffocation but offers general insights into dreams and dealing with distress. For instance, Psalm 55:22 encourages casting care upon the Lord for sustenance during trying times. While specific instances of suffocating dreams aren’t discussed, various scriptures deal with dreams and visions, often highlighting God’s communication or providing divine guidance.

Biblical Perspectives on Dreams

Dreams have always held a certain mystique, haven’t they? In the Bible, they take a special place, often serving as a divine hotline of sorts, where God communicates, warns, and guides individuals. Joseph, with his prophetic dreams, is a classic example.

“Behold, I have dreamed another dream. Behold, the sun, the moon, and eleven stars were bowing down to me.”

Genesis 37:9

And then there’s Nebuchadnezzar, whose perplexing dreams needed Daniel’s divine interpretations.

“I had a dream, and my spirit is troubled to know the dream.”

Daniel 2:3

While the Bible doesn’t specifically discuss dreams of suffocation, it does suggest that dreams can be meaningful and, at times, prophetic, providing insights, warnings, or reassurances from the divine to guide us in our spiritual journey.

Interpretation of Distressing Dreams in the Bible

Let’s chat about dreams, especially the tough ones that might have us waking up a bit shaken. The Bible, while not a dream dictionary, does give us some pretty cool insights into how to navigate through those tricky, sometimes scary, nighttime stories our brains cook up.

Remember King Nebuchadnezzar? His dreams were anything but sweet and simple. They were kind of scary and super confusing.

“I saw a dream that made me afraid. As I lay in bed the fancies and the visions of my head alarmed me.”

Daniel 4:5

But here’s where the Bible brings in a beacon of light. Daniel, a man deeply connected with God, steps in to interpret the king’s distressing dreams, providing not just an interpretation but also divine counsel and wisdom.

“Daniel declared, ‘I saw in my vision by night, and behold, the four winds of heaven were stirring up the great sea.'”

Daniel 7:2

In the midst of our own distressing dreams, the Bible gently nudges us towards seeking understanding and wisdom from God, just like Daniel did. It’s not about deciphering a code, but about seeking and understanding the heart and character of God in the midst of our nighttime wanderings.

“If any of you lacks wisdom, let him ask God, who gives generously to all without reproach, and it will be given him.”

James 1:5

So, while dreams of suffocation or distress might not be explicitly unpacked in the Bible, the overarching theme is clear: In our search for meaning, especially in the shadowy realms of distressing dreams, turning to God for wisdom, understanding, and peace is encouraged and celebrated.
